When we fall back and turn the clocks from 2 am back to 1 am, what happens to the first recording from 1 am to 2 am?

I have a Dahua DHI-NVR5216-4KS2.

So I opened up SmartPSS this morning, and this is what I see for 00:30:00 to 02:30:00:

1604243359158.png

Looks like I can only retrieve one of the two recordings from 01:00 to 02:00 - and I'm not sure which it is - the first or the second - today is 25 hours long, but SmartPSS is just showing it as a 24 hour day




Similiar with the webgui on the NVR:

1604243467637.png


However, the Google Nest cam is showing the 25 hour day, and allows me to view both 01:00 to 02:00 recordings:

1604244261584.png

I think what I’m going to do is just setup the dahua nvr to run on UTC, that way I don’t lose an hour of recording next year in the fall again

Really disappointed that dahua didn’t implement DST properly

This is from a Hikvision NVR when DST ended, last weekend. The hour repeats, and no alerts are lost.
The detail is a bit hard to see.
View attachment 73940
Yeah, that’s what the Google Nest does, and I was expecting the Dahua to do the same, but the Dahua doesn’t. DST is broken on both the Dahua nvr, and on the Dahua cams (I have SD cards in the cams and they don’t show both 1-2 am recordings either)
